4.1 Performance Tuning: From Suspension Geometry to ECU Mapping
Adjust camber angles to hug corners better, starting at -1.5 degrees for front wheels. Caster affects steering feel—higher values give more stability at speed. Toe settings fine-tune straight-line tracking, with slight toe-in reducing wander.
Gear ratios let you shorten for acceleration or lengthen for top speed. Differential locks help in rallies, locking up to 80% for better traction out of hairpins. Brake bias shifts front-to-rear, say 60-40 for trail braking into turns.
ECU mapping alters power delivery; soft mode smooths throttle for beginners, while race mode unleashes full torque. Test changes in practice mode to see lap time gains, often 2-3 seconds with good tweaks.
These options make every car unique to your style.

4.3 Actionable Tip: Optimizing Your First Car Setup
For your starter car in basic circuit racing, balance tire pressures at 32 PSI front and rear. This gives even grip without overheat. Set differential preload to 20 Nm for stability under acceleration—too low causes wheel spin on exits.
Run a quick test lap. If the rear steps out, stiffen the sway bar by one click. These changes shave seconds off times without big upgrades.
